Android-cuttlefish cvd tool
Functions | Variables
cuttlefish::anonymous_namespace{boot_image_utils.cc} Namespace Reference

Functions

void RunMkBootFs (const std::string &input_dir, const std::string &output)
 
void RunLz4 (const std::string &input, const std::string &output)
 
std::string ExtractValue (const std::string &dictionary, const std::string &key)
 
bool DeleteTmpFileIfNotChanged (const std::string &tmp_file, const std::string &current_file)
 
void RepackVendorRamdisk (const std::string &kernel_modules_ramdisk_path, const std::string &original_ramdisk_path, const std::string &new_ramdisk_path, const std::string &build_dir)
 
bool IsCpioArchive (const std::string &path)
 

Variables

constexpr char TMP_EXTENSION [] = ".tmp"
 
constexpr char kCpioExt [] = ".cpio"
 
constexpr char TMP_RD_DIR [] = "stripped_ramdisk_dir"
 
constexpr char STRIPPED_RD [] = "stripped_ramdisk"
 
constexpr char kConcatenatedVendorRamdisk [] = "concatenated_vendor_ramdisk"
 

Function Documentation

◆ DeleteTmpFileIfNotChanged()

bool cuttlefish::anonymous_namespace{boot_image_utils.cc}::DeleteTmpFileIfNotChanged ( const std::string &  tmp_file,
const std::string &  current_file 
)

◆ ExtractValue()

std::string cuttlefish::anonymous_namespace{boot_image_utils.cc}::ExtractValue ( const std::string &  dictionary,
const std::string &  key 
)

◆ IsCpioArchive()

bool cuttlefish::anonymous_namespace{boot_image_utils.cc}::IsCpioArchive ( const std::string &  path)

◆ RepackVendorRamdisk()

void cuttlefish::anonymous_namespace{boot_image_utils.cc}::RepackVendorRamdisk ( const std::string &  kernel_modules_ramdisk_path,
const std::string &  original_ramdisk_path,
const std::string &  new_ramdisk_path,
const std::string &  build_dir 
)

◆ RunLz4()

void cuttlefish::anonymous_namespace{boot_image_utils.cc}::RunLz4 ( const std::string &  input,
const std::string &  output 
)

◆ RunMkBootFs()

void cuttlefish::anonymous_namespace{boot_image_utils.cc}::RunMkBootFs ( const std::string &  input_dir,
const std::string &  output 
)

Variable Documentation

◆ kConcatenatedVendorRamdisk

constexpr char cuttlefish::anonymous_namespace{boot_image_utils.cc}::kConcatenatedVendorRamdisk[] = "concatenated_vendor_ramdisk"
constexpr

◆ kCpioExt

constexpr char cuttlefish::anonymous_namespace{boot_image_utils.cc}::kCpioExt[] = ".cpio"
constexpr

◆ STRIPPED_RD

constexpr char cuttlefish::anonymous_namespace{boot_image_utils.cc}::STRIPPED_RD[] = "stripped_ramdisk"
constexpr

◆ TMP_EXTENSION

constexpr char cuttlefish::anonymous_namespace{boot_image_utils.cc}::TMP_EXTENSION[] = ".tmp"
constexpr

◆ TMP_RD_DIR

constexpr char cuttlefish::anonymous_namespace{boot_image_utils.cc}::TMP_RD_DIR[] = "stripped_ramdisk_dir"
constexpr